Making the Most of Your Break Time: Combining Travel and Business Opportunities

Taking a break from work can be a great way to recharge and refocus. But what if you could use that break time to also explore new business opportunities and expand your professional network? In this post, we’ll explore some tips for combining travel and business opportunities.

First, consider attending conferences or trade shows while on vacation. These events can be a great way to network with other professionals in your industry and learn about the latest trends and innovations. Plus, many conferences and trade shows are held in popular travel destinations, so you can combine business with pleasure.

Second, consider taking a business trip and extending your stay for a few extra days to explore the local area. This can be a great way to get a taste of local culture and gain inspiration for new business ideas. For example, if you’re in the tech industry, you might visit Silicon Valley and then take some time to explore San Francisco and the surrounding area.

Third, consider working remotely while on vacation. With the rise of digital nomads and remote work, it’s easier than ever to work from anywhere in the world. This can be a great way to maintain productivity while also exploring new destinations and cultures. Just be sure to plan ahead and make sure you have reliable internet access and a quiet workspace.

Fourth, consider taking a volunteer trip that aligns with your professional interests. For example, if you work in marketing, you might volunteer with a nonprofit that focuses on marketing for social causes. This can be a great way to gain hands-on experience and expand your network while also making a positive impact. Finally, consider starting a side hustle while on vacation. This could involve launching an e-commerce store selling local products, starting a travel blog, or even launching a new business idea that you’ve been thinking about. With a little creativity and resourcefulness, there are endless possibilities for combining travel and entrepreneurship.
